在编写代码时突然需要插图?为前端页面寻找素材?在 Cursor 中,您可以使用 Midjourney 生成图像------无需切换窗口,无需 Discord,只需一个命令即可完成。
这便是 MCP(模型上下文协议)+ Midjourney 的强大之处。
为什么要将 Midjourney 集成到 Cursor 中?
- 无缝工作流程 --- 在编码时直接在编辑器中生成图像资产
- 自动集成到项目中 --- 让 AI 理解您的项目上下文并生成匹配的图像
- 批量生产 --- 需要一组统一风格的图标/插图?只需一个提示
- 无需 Discord --- 直接调用 API,绕过 Discord 繁琐的操作
5 分钟设置
在项目根目录下创建 .cursor/mcp.json 文件:
json
{
"mcpServers": {
"midjourney": {
"type": "streamable-http",
"url": "https://midjourney.mcp.acedata.cloud/mcp",
"headers": {
"Authorization": "Bearer 你的API_TOKEN"
}
}
}
}
保存后,Cursor 将自动加载 MCP 工具。重新打开 AI 面板,您将看到与 Midjourney 相关的工具。
其他编辑器的使用
VS Code(GitHub Copilot)
在 .vscode/mcp.json 中添加:
json
{
"servers": {
"midjourney": {
"type": "streamable-http",
"url": "https://midjourney.mcp.acedata.cloud/mcp",
"headers": {
"Authorization": "Bearer 你的API_TOKEN"
}
}
}
}
Windsurf
在 .windsurf/mcp.json 中添加:
json
{
"mcpServers": {
"midjourney": {
"type": "streamable-http",
"url": "https://midjourney.mcp.acedata.cloud/mcp",
"headers": {
"Authorization": "Bearer 你的API_TOKEN"
}
}
}
}
Cline
在 .cline/mcp_settings.json 中添加:
json
{
"mcpServers": {
"midjourney": {
"type": "streamable-http",
"url": "https://midjourney.mcp.acedata.cloud/mcp",
"headers": {
"Authorization": "Bearer 你的API_TOKEN"
}
}
}
}
实际场景
场景 1:为登陆页面生成英雄图像
"生成一幅科技感的英雄图像,蓝紫色调,发光颗粒,适合 SaaS 产品主页"
AI 调用 imagine 工具,根据描述生成高质量图像,您可以直接在项目中使用。
场景 2:批量生成应用图标
"使用 Midjourney 生成一组扁平风格的图标:设置、用户、通知、搜索、收藏。统一风格,白色背景"
场景 3:图像变体和编辑
"将此图像的背景改为森林场景"
"生成此图像的 4 个变体"
AI 调用 edits 工具进行重绘或变体生成。
场景 4:图像转视频
"将此产品图像制作成 5 秒的动态展示视频"
AI 调用 video 工具从静态图像生成短视频。
支持的工具
| 工具 | 功能 |
|---|---|
imagine |
文本转图像生成 |
blend |
混合多张图像 |
describe |
AI 描述图像内容 |
edits |
图像编辑(本地重绘、变体) |
video |
图像转视频生成 |
translate |
翻译为英文描述 |
生成模式
| 模式 | 速度 | 适用场景 |
|---|---|---|
fast |
快速 | 日常创作 |
turbo |
超快 | 紧急生产 |
relax |
慢 | 批量任务,不急 |
如何获取 API Token
- 注册 AceData Cloud
- 访问 Midjourney API 文档
- 点击"获取"以获取您的 Token
总结
将 Midjourney MCP 集成到 Cursor/VS Code/Windsurf 中,让您的 AI 编码助手同时成为设计助手。在编码时生成图像,双倍提升开发效率。
立即尝试:https://platform.acedata.cloud
相关链接:
技术标签:#AI #Midjourney #代码助手 #设计工具 #开发效率